To pay for general services like police, schools, firefighters, libraries, and hospitals, the government of Newport, Kentucky collects taxes.

Taxes in Newport, Kentucky are derived from a wide number of sources. Regardless of the source, however, the amount that's taken is never arbitrary, and is always decided by law. A tax can come either in the form of a flat fee, or as a percentage of one's income, the value of a piece of property, or a sale.

You are legally-obligated to pay your taxes in Newport. If you fail to pay your taxes, without a compelling reason, you are committing a crime, and may end up going to jail as a result.

Sources of Tax Dollars in Newport, Kentucky

A wide number of activities are subject to taxation in Newport, Kentucky, creating a considerable range of revenue sources. For example, cities typically impose a sales tax, charge fees for certain licenses, and collect tolls on roads and bridges.

Sales Tax: In Newport, there may be a sales tax on top of the sales tax imposed by the government of . City sales taxes are typically pretty small, typically in the range of one percent or less, as opposed to the 5-7% sales taxes imposed by most states.

Licensing Fees: The government of Newport issues licenses for engaging in a wide number of different activities. Most frequently, they issue business licenses, which business owners must obtain before operating any type of business in city limit. The most important of this process is usually paying a fee. While these taxes are called "fees," instead of "taxes," they are functionally identical, and serve the same purpose (namely, raising revenue).

Bridge/Road Tolls: Most large cities in the U.S. charge fees, or tolls, on automobiles entering the city via public bridges and highways. This money is, more or less, a tax on everybody who drives into Newport via public infrastructure. This means that everyone who visits is obligated to make at least a small contribution to the government services they'll be using while there.
